A Dagestani teenager is facing trial for "justifying terrorism."
In Dagestan, a teenager is facing trial on charges of promoting terrorism. The criminal investigation against the minor has been completed. He is charged with publicly justifying terrorism (Part 2 of Article 205.2 of the Russian Criminal Code), which carries a prison sentence of up to seven years.
According to law enforcement, in December 2024, the accused appeared online through videos on a messaging app, calling for and justifying terrorist activity. These posts were publicly accessible.
The case has been sent to the prosecutor for indictment, after which it will be submitted to the court. Details regarding the perpetrator's identity, preventive measures, and his position as a defendant have not yet been released.
